Labour leader Keir Starmer has set out what he would do for Greater Manchester if he becomes Prime Minister. In a wide-ranging interview with the Manchester Evening News, Sir Keir spoke about transport, housing and devolution as well as the conflict in the Middle East.

He also discussed his relationship with Andy Burnham and revealed how he would spend a day off in Manchester. He told the M.E.N.

that he wants to work 'hand in glove' with Greater Manchester's mayor and wants to put more power in the hands of local leaders.

Sir Keir also said that Labour would not bring HS2 to Manchester, revealing that he has ruled this out as an option. The interview came after the leader of the opposition was quizzed by schoolkids who he met at the M.E.N.
